What Does NSMCF Do?
Northern Sphere Mining Corp., formerly Argentium Resources Inc., changed its name in August 2015 and is focused on the acquisition, exploration, and development of precious and base metal projects. The company operates within the industrial materials sector, searching for economically viable mineral deposits. As a mineral exploration company, Northern Sphere engages in identifying and securing prospective mining properties, conducting geological surveys, and performing drilling operations to assess the quality and quantity of mineral resources. The company's strategy centers around acquiring early-stage projects with the potential for significant resource discoveries. Northern Sphere's activities are primarily based in North America, with a focus on regions known for their geological potential. The company's success depends on its ability to identify, acquire, and develop promising mineral properties, as well as its ability to secure funding for exploration and development activities. Northern Sphere Mining Corp. is headquartered in Toronto, Canada.

NSMCF OTC Market Information
The OTC Other tier represents the lowest tier of the OTC market, characterized by companies that may not meet minimum financial standards or reporting requirements. Companies in this tier may have limited financial disclosure, making it difficult for investors to assess their financial health and prospects. Investing in OTC Other stocks carries significant risks due to the lack of regulatory oversight and potential for fraud or manipulation. These companies are not required to adhere to the same listing standards as those on major exchanges like the NYSE or NASDAQ.
